1. A good carrier should support your baby in an “M-shaped” position (knees higher than bottom). This helps: * Promote healthy hip development * Reduce strain on developing joints * Keep baby comfortable for longer periods Without proper support, baby’s legs can dangle, which may place unnecessary pressure on their hips, especially in those early months when everything is still developing. 2. Parents often overlook this… until their back starts hurting. A well-designed carrier should: * Distribute baby’s weight evenly across your shoulders and hips * Include lumbar support to protect your lower back * Prevent pressure points that cause fatigue This matters because most parents wear carriers for longer than expected, walks, errands, naps on-the-go.�If it’s not comfortable, you simply won’t use it. 3. Babies grow fast, and a carrier needs to grow with them. Adjustability allows: * A proper fit from newborn → toddler * Custom support for different body sizes (both baby and parent) * Longer product lifespan (better value, less replacing) Without this, you risk: * Outgrowing the carrier too quickly * Poor positioning as baby changes 4. This is a big one, especially in warmer climates or for active parents.
